#769BDD Hex color
The hexadecimal color code #769BDD corresponds to the code RGB( 118, 155, 221 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,46 level), green (at 0,61 level) and blue (at 0,87 level). Its brightness is 66% and its saturation is 60%. It is composed of red at 23%, green at 31% and blue at 44%.

The complementary color #896422 is the color exactly opposite to #769BDD on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.
